Выбрать ячейку/ Activate cell
Делает выбранную ячейку активной.
Настройки
Свойство | Англ. наименование | Описание | Тип | Пример заполнения | Обязательность заполнения поля |
---|---|---|---|---|---|
Контекст | Context | Уникальный идентификатор сеанса, к которому будет применено действие | Robin.Excel | ExelInstance*, где * - порядковый номер контекста, запущенного в данном алгоритме | О |
Имя листа | Sheet name | Наименование страницы, к которой будет применено действие | Строка | Лист1 | Н |
Индекс листа | Sheet index | Индекс (порядковый номер) страницы, к которой будет применено действие. | Строка | 1 | Н |
Ячейка | Cell | Адрес ячейки, которая будет активной. Заполнять в формате "ХY", где "Х" - это номер столбца, а "Y" - номер строки. | Строка | A2 | О |
Особые условия использования
Стиль ссылок "R1C1" не поддерживается.
Пример использования
Задача:
Существует Excel-документ "Test.xlsx".
Необходимо сделать ячейку "B2" активной.
Решение:
- Для любых действий с конкретным Excel-документом, необходимо сперва открыть документ, создать его уникальный идентификатор (Контекст), чтобы в дальнейшем обращать действия именно к конкретному документу. Открыть документ "Test.xlsx".
- Сделать заданную ячейку активной.
- Сохранить документ.
Реализация:
- Открываем группу действий "Excel".
- Помещаем в рабочее пространство студии действие "Открыть" (см. описание действия "Открыть").
- Помещаем в рабочее пространство студии действие "Очистить ячейку".
Настройка действия:- Параметр "Контекст". Выбираем из выпадающего списка контекст соответствующий файлу "Test.xlsx".
- Параметр "Ячейка". Указываем наименование ячейки, которая должна быть активна.
- Помещаем в рабочее пространство студии действие "Сохранить документ" (см. описание действия "Сохранить документ").
- Запускаем робота по кнопке "Запуск" в верхней панели.
Результат:
В документе заданная ячейка активна.
Получить текст из ячейки
/ Cell text
Запоминает текст из указанной ячейки
Настройки
Свойство | Англ. наименование | Описание | Тип | Пример заполнения | Обязательность заполнения поля |
---|---|---|---|---|---|
Контекст | Context | Уникальный идентификатор сеанса, к которому будет применено действие | Robin.Excel | EXCEL_INSTANCE | О |
Имя листа | Sheet name | Наименование страницы, к которой будет применено действие | Строка | Лист2 | Н |
Индекс листа | Sheet index | Индекс (порядковый номер) страницы, к которой будет применено действие. Порядковый номер начинается с "1" | Строка | 1 | Н |
Ячейка | Cell | Адрес ячейки, из которой будет взято значение. Заполнять в формате "ХY", где "Х" - это номер столбца, а "Y" - номер строки. | Строка | B3 | О |
Результат | Result | Значение из ячейки | Строка | Result | О |
Особые условия использования
Стиль ссылок "R1C1" не поддерживается.
Пример использования
Задача:
Существует Excel-документ "Test.xlsx".
Необходимо получить текст из ячейки "А2".
Решение:
- Для любых действий с конкретным Excel-документом, необходимо сперва открыть документ, создать его уникальный идентификатор (Контекст), чтобы в дальнейшем обращать действия именно к конкретному документу. Открыть документ "Test.xlsx".
- Взять текст из ячейки.
Реализация:
- Открываем группу действий "Excel".
- Открываем подгруппу "Ячейки"
- Помещаем в рабочее пространство студии действие "Открыть" (см. описание действия "Открыть").
- Помещаем в рабочее пространство студии действие "Получить текст из ячейки".
Настройка действия:- Параметр "Контекст". Выбираем из выпадающего списка контекст соответствующий файлу "Test.xlsx".
- Параметр "Ячейка". Указываем адрес ячейки, из которой необходимо взять текст.
- Параметр "Результат". Указываем переменную, в которую будет записан текст из ячейки.
- Запускаем робота по кнопке "Запуск" в верхней панели.
Результат:
Переменная "ФИО" содержит значение "Иванов Иван Иванович".
Значение из ячейки / Cell value
Запоминает значение из указанной ячейки
Настройки
Свойство | Англ. наименование | Описание | Тип | Пример заполнения | Обязательность заполнения поля |
---|---|---|---|---|---|
Контекст | Context | Уникальный идентификатор сеанса, к которому будет применено действие | Robin.Excel | EXCEL_INSTANCE | О |
Имя листа | Sheet name | Наименование страницы, к которой будет применено действие | Строка | Лист2 | Н |
Индекс листа | Sheet index | Индекс (порядковый номер) страницы, к которой будет применено действие. Порядковый номер начинается с "1" | Строка | 1 | Н |
Ячейка | Cell | Адрес ячейки, из которой будет взято значение. Заполнять в формате "ХY", где "Х" - это номер столбца, а "Y" - номер строки. | Строка | B4 | О |
Результат | Result | Переменная, в которую будет записано значение из ячейки | Строка / Дата / Число | 5 | О |
Особые условия использования
Стиль ссылок "R1C1" не поддерживается.
Пример использования
Задача:
Существует Excel-документ "Test.xlsx".
Необходимо получить значение из ячейки "B2".
Значение ячейки записать в переменную типа "Число". Наименование переменной "Сумма".
Решение:
- Для любых действий с конкретным Excel-документом, необходимо сперва открыть документ, создать его уникальный идентификатор (Контекст), чтобы в дальнейшем обращать действия именно к конкретному документу. Открыть документ "Test.xlsx".
- Записать значение в ячейку.
Реализация:
- Открываем группу действий "Excel".
- Открываем подгруппу "Ячейки"
- Помещаем в рабочее пространство студии действие "Открыть" (см. описание действия "Открыть").
- Помещаем в рабочее пространство студии действие "Получить текст из ячейки".
Настройка действия:- Параметр "Контекст". Выбираем из выпадающего списка контекст соответствующий файлу "Test.xlsx".
- Параметр "Ячейка". Указываем адрес ячейки, из которой необходимо взять значение
- Параметр "Результат". Указываем переменную, в которую будет записано значение из ячейки.
- Запускаем робота по кнопке "Запуск" в верхней панели.
Результат:
Переменная "Сумма" содержит значение "6500,74".
Проверить пустая ли ячейка / Is cell empty
Проверяет отсутствие значения в ячейке.
Настройки
Свойство | Англ. наименование | Описание | Тип | Пример заполнения | Обязательность заполнения поля |
---|---|---|---|---|---|
Контекст | Context | Уникальный идентификатор сеанса, к которому будет применено действие | Robin.Excel | EXCEL_INSTANCE | О |
Имя листа | Sheet name | Наименование страницы, к которой будет применено действие | Строка | Лист2 | Н |
Индекс листа | Sheet index | Индекс (порядковый номер) страницы, к которой будет применено действие. Порядковый номер начинается с "1" | Строка | 1 | Н |
Ячейка | Cell | Адрес ячейки, из которой будет взято значение. Заполнять в формате "ХY", где "Х" - это номер столбца, а "Y" - номер строки. | Строка | B4 | О |
Результат | Result | Переменная, в которую будет записано значение из ячейки. Если ячейка:
| Чек-бокс | False | О |
Особые условия использования
Стиль ссылок "R1C1" не поддерживается.
Пример использования
Задача:
Существует Excel-документ "Test.xlsx".
Необходимо получить информацию о наличии значения в ячейке "B2".
Информацию о наличии значения записать в переменную типа "Чек-бокс". Наименование переменной "Значение_ячейки".
Решение:
- Для любых действий с конкретным Excel-документом, необходимо сперва открыть документ, создать его уникальный идентификатор (Контекст), чтобы в дальнейшем обращать действия именно к конкретному документу. Открыть документ "Test.xlsx".
- Установить признак наличия данных в ячейки.
Реализация:
- Открываем группу действий "Excel".
- Помещаем в рабочее пространство студии действие "Открыть" (см. описание действия "Открыть").
- Помещаем в рабочее пространство студии действие "Ячейка пустая".
Настройка действия:- Параметр "Контекст". Выбираем из выпадающего списка контекст соответствующий файлу "Test.xlsx".
- Параметр "Ячейка". Указываем адрес ячейки, из которой необходимо взять значение.
- Параметр "Результат". Указываем переменную, в которую будет записано значение из ячейки.
- Запускаем робота по кнопке "Запуск" в верхней панели.
Результат:
Значение переменной "Значение_ячейки" = False.
Установить значение ячейки / Set cell value
Устанавливает значение в указанную ячейку.
Настройки
Свойство | Англ. наименование | Описание | Тип | Пример заполнения | Обязательность заполнения поля |
---|---|---|---|---|---|
Параметры | |||||
Контекст | Context | Уникальный идентификатор сеанса, к которому будет применено действие | Robin.Excel | EXCEL_INSTANCE | Да |
Имя листа | Sheet name | Наименование страницы, к которой будет применено действие | Robin.String | Лист2 | Нет |
Индекс листа | Sheet index | Индекс (порядковый номер) страницы, к которой будет применено действие. Порядковый номер начинается с "1" | Robin.Numeric | 1 | Нет |
Ячейка | Cell | Адрес ячейки, в которую будет записано значение. Заполнять в формате "ХY", где "Х" - это номер столбца, а "Y" - номер строки. | Robin.String | A1 | Да |
Значение | Value | Значение, которое будет записано в выбранную ячейку. Формат результирующих данных в ячейке должен соответствовать типу введенных данных. В случаях, когда соответствие невозможно, формат ячейки меняется на общий. | Robin.String или Robin.Object если это эффективнее | 5000ед | Да |
Особые условия использования
Стиль ссылок "R1C1" не поддерживается. Если в ячейке уже есть данные, они будут перезаписаны.
Пример использования
Задача:
Существует Excel-документ "Test.xlsx".
Необходимо записать в ячейку "B2" значение переменной "Сумма".
Значение переменной "Сумма" = 89265555517"
Решение:
- Для любых действий с конкретным Excel-документом, необходимо сперва открыть документ, создать его уникальный идентификатор (Контекст), чтобы в дальнейшем обращать действия именно к конкретному документу. Открыть документ "Test.xlsx".
- Установить значение в ячейку.
- Сохранить документ.
Реализация:
- Открываем группу действий "Excel".
- Помещаем в рабочее пространство студии действие "Установить значение ячейки".
Настройка действия:- Параметр "Контекст". Выбираем из выпадающего списка контекст соответствующий файлу "Test.xlsx".
- Параметр "Ячейка". Указываем ячейку, в которую будет записано значение.
- Параметр "Значение". Указываем переменную, значение которой будет записано в ячейку.
- Помещаем в рабочее пространство студии действие "Сохранить документ" (см. описание действия "Сохранить документ").
- Запускаем робота по кнопке "Запуск" в верхней панели.
Результат:
Значение переменной "Телефон" записано в ячейку "B2".
Очистить ячейку / Clear cell
Удаляет значение из заданной ячейки.
Настройки
Свойство | Англ. наименование | Описание | Тип | Пример заполнения | Обязательность заполнения поля |
---|---|---|---|---|---|
Контекст | Context | Уникальный идентификатор сеанса, к которому будет применено действие | Robin.Excel | ExelInstance*, где * - порядковый номер контекста, запущенного в данном алгоритме | О |
Имя листа | Sheet name | Наименование страницы, к которой будет применено действие | Строка | Лист1 | Н |
Индекс листа | Sheet index | Индекс (порядковый номер) страницы, к которой будет применено действие. | Строка | 1 | Н |
Ячейка | Cell | Адрес ячейки, значение которой будет очищено. Заполнять в формате "ХY", где "Х" - это номер столбца, а "Y" - номер строки. | Строка | B2 | О |
Особые условия использования
Стиль ссылок "R1C1" не поддерживается.
Пример использования
Задача:
Существует Excel-документ "Test.xlsx".
Необходимо очистить значение ячейки "B2".
Решение:
- Для любых действий с конкретным Excel-документом, необходимо сперва открыть документ, создать его уникальный идентификатор (Контекст), чтобы в дальнейшем обращать действия именно к конкретному документу. Открыть документ "Test.xlsx".
- Очистить значение заданной ячейки.
- Сохранить документ.
Реализация:
- Открываем группу действий "Excel".
- Помещаем в рабочее пространство студии действие "Открыть" (см. описание действия "Открыть").
- Помещаем в рабочее пространство студии действие "Очистить ячейку".
Настройка действия:- Параметр "Контекст". Выбираем из выпадающего списка контекст соответствующий файлу "Test.xlsx".
- Параметр "Ячейка". Указываем наименование ячейки, значение в которой должно быть очищено.
- Помещаем в рабочее пространство студии действие "Сохранить документ" (см. описание действия "Сохранить документ").
- Запускаем робота по кнопке "Запуск" в верхней панели.
Результат:
В документе очищены данные из заданной ячейки.